📝 Color Information for #C2B089

The hexadecimal color code #C2B089 represents a light shade in the orange family. In the RGB color model, this color is composed of 194 red, 176 green, and 137 blue, which translates to approximately 76% red, 69% green, and 54% blue. This makes it a slightly desaturated color with warm undertones that can evoke different emotional responses depending on its application. When analyzed in the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, #C2B089 has a hue of 41 degrees, a saturation level of 32%, and a lightness value of 65%. The hue angle of 41° places this color firmly in the orange spectrum. In the HSV/HSB color model, this translates to a hue of 41°, saturation of 29%, and brightness/value of 76%. For print applications using the CMYK color model, #C2B089 would be reproduced using 0% cyan, 9% magenta, 29% yellow, and 24% black. The closest web-safe color is #CC9999, which may be useful for ensuring compatibility across older displays and systems. This color works well in various design contexts. With its medium lightness, it's versatile enough for both foreground elements and subtle backgrounds. The moderate to low saturation gives this color a sophisticated, muted quality that works well in professional and minimalist designs. When pairing #C2B089 with other colors, consider its complementary color at hue 221° for maximum contrast, or use analogous colors within 30° of its hue for harmonious combinations. The decimal representation of this color is 12759177, which can be useful in certain programming contexts.

What is the CMYK value of #C2B089? +

The approximate CMYK value of #C2B089 is C:0% M:9% Y:29% K:24%. C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Key/Black) is the color model used in physical printing. Unlike RGB which mixes light additively on screens, CMYK mixes inks subtractively on paper. Note that the RGB-to-CMYK conversion is an approximation — screen colors and print colors exist in different color gamuts, and some screen colors cannot be exactly reproduced in print. For precise print work, consult a professional print color profile or Pantone matching system.
